Transportation Requirements

Standards for carriers and drivers hauling equipment for Creative Equipment Solutions, LLC.

All drivers / haulers must be able to self-load and unload all units.

All drivers / haulers must have personal protective equipment (PPE).

Driver must perform a visual inspection of the unit prior to loading. If damages are present, notate the damage and contact CES immediately.

All drivers / haulers are responsible for their own loads. Ensure all components of the equipment are secure. The driver / hauler will be responsible for any damages resulting from improperly securing or inspecting their load.

Required Photos (Minimum 6)

  • • 4 corner pictures — entire machine visible in each photo (not too far).
  • • 1 picture of the basket (or attachment if earth-moving equipment).
  • • 1 picture of the safety pin (all aerial units, if applicable).

Once the driver arrives at the drop-off location, please make sure CES receives a signed BOL. If any damage is noticed, it must be documented on the paperwork with photos.

Rate Reduction Clause

CES will deduct $250 if we do not receive the minimum required photos when the unit is loaded and chained down. Do not send photos of the chains. If chain photos are sent, they will be rejected with the assumption that photos were not provided and the deduction will stand.

Dedicated Loads Only

All CES lanes are dedicated loads — partial loads will not be allowed. CES tracks all units via GPS; if a carrier deviates from the assigned route, proof of stops will be provided and $500 will be deducted from the invoice.
